How does the endocrine system affect the excretory system?

Hint: Endocrine system refers to different organs and glands that secrete various hormones that reach the specific organ or tissue of the body.
Complete answer:
1)The functioning of the endocrine system and the excretory system helps to regulate many other functions of the body.
2)Hypothalamus which is an endocrine gland can easily detect the water levels in the body and can stimulate the release of different enzymes to maintain the proper water and fluid level in the body.
3)The hypothalamus cannot directly detect the water level but it can do so by detecting the electrolytic content of the body, if a body has comparatively low electrolytes, the hypothalamus detects this condition as over hydration whereas the higher electrolytic concentration describes dehydration of the body. Now accordingly, the hypothalamus stimulates the release of enzymes.
4)When the body is dehydrated, the antidiuretic hormone is released from the pituitary gland which absorbs water from the nephron of the kidney and brings the water level back to its normal level. Thus the endocrine system can affect the excretory system to regulate the fluid balance of the body.
Note: Along with the antidiuretic hormone, aldosterone also plays a great role in maintaining fluid balance. The aldosterone hormone does not absorb water, but it regulates the ions and electrolytes present in the body which indirectly maintains the fluid balance of the body. The aldosterone hormone is released by the adrenal gland.
